
时间:2024-11-02 来源:网络 人气:
在C语言编程中,调用系统API是开发者日常工作中不可或缺的一部分。系统API(Application Programming Interface,应用程序编程接口)提供了一套预先定义好的函数,使得开发者能够方便地访问操作系统提供的各种服务。本文将深入解析C语言调用系统API的原理,并通过实例展示如何在实际编程中应用这些API。
API是应用程序与操作系统或其他应用程序之间交互的桥梁。它定义了函数、数据类型、协议等,使得不同的软件组件能够相互通信。在C语言中,API通常以函数库的形式存在,开发者通过包含相应的头文件来使用这些函数。
调用系统API的过程可以分为以下几个步骤:
包含头文件:在C程序中,首先需要包含包含所需API函数定义的头文件。例如,调用Windows API中的MessageBox函数,需要包含头文件:
include
声明函数:在函数声明部分,声明要调用的API函数。例如:
MessageBox(HWND hWnd, LPCTSTR lpText, LPCTSTR lpCaption, UINT uType);
调用函数:在函数调用部分,使用API函数并传入相应的参数。例如:
MessageBox(NULL,